diff --git a/roles/commcare_analytics/defaults/main.yml b/roles/commcare_analytics/defaults/main.yml index ac62eab..5eb061a 100644 --- a/roles/commcare_analytics/defaults/main.yml +++ b/roles/commcare_analytics/defaults/main.yml @@ -69,7 +69,7 @@ superset_environment: FLASK_APP: superset SUPERSET_CONFIG_PATH: '{{ superset_project_dir }}/superset_config.py' -gunicorn_num_workers: 20 +gunicorn_num_workers: 32 gunicorn_max_requests: 0 gunicorn_reload_workers: true gunicorn_timeout_seconds: 900 diff --git a/roles/commcare_analytics/templates/superset/celery_default_start_script.j2 b/roles/commcare_analytics/templates/superset/celery_default_start_script.j2 index 9c84c28..e705795 100644 --- a/roles/commcare_analytics/templates/superset/celery_default_start_script.j2 +++ b/roles/commcare_analytics/templates/superset/celery_default_start_script.j2 @@ -16,5 +16,5 @@ exec celery --app superset.tasks.celery_app:app \ --loglevel INFO \ --logfile {{ log_dir }}/celery.log \ -Q celery \ - --concurrency 10 \ + --concurrency 5 \ -B